The Sydney Roosters are delighted to announce that foundation player Brydie Parker has re-committed to the Club through to the end of the 2027 NRLW season.
Parker, who has won two Premierships with the Roosters to date (2021, 2024), continues to be one of the most reliable and versatile backs in the competition.
“I’m excited to extend my time with the Sydney Roosters, I love my Chookies family,” said Parker.
“The Roosters gave me my first opportunity and this team means so much to me. I’m so proud that this will continue to be my home, and I can’t wait to see what we achieve together over the next few years,” she added.
Roosters NRLW Head Coach, John Strange, welcomed the news, saying: “Brydie’s athleticism and consistency make her an important part of our team.
“Brydie also brings a real energy and positivity to everything she does that lifts everyone around her, so securing her for the long term is fantastic for our Club,” he added.
